Thesis (PH.D.) - Cairo University - Faculty Of Science - Department Of Biophysics
The thesis comprises the preparation of some silicate and phosphate glass - ceramics and the characterization of the prepared samples to investigate their structureAlso , in vitro and in vivo tests for the prepared samples were carried out to investigate their bioactivityThe basic silicate glasses were of the system SiO2 - CaO - Na2O - P2O5 , where the effect of addition of MgO and / or TiO2 on the bioactivity was investigatedThe basic phosphate glasses were of the system P2O5 - CaO - Na2O , where the effect of addition of TiO2 on the bioactivity was investigated The parent glasses were prepared from chemically pure raw materialsMelting of the weighed batches was carried out in an electric furnace using platinum crucibles at about 1450 oC for the silicate glasses , and using porcelain crucibles at about 1150 oC for phosphate glassesThe homogenized melts were poured and annealed in a regulated muffle furnace at 470 oC for the silicate glasses , and at 350 oC for the phosphate glasses The parent glasses were converted to their corresponding glass - ceramics by controlled heat - treatment regime using the thermal analysis data of the samplesThe prepared glass - ceramic samples were characterized using X - ray diffraction measurements to identify the crystalline phases present in the samplesAlso , the infrared absorption spectroscopy and Raman Spectroscopy were used to investigate the structure of samplesScanning electron microscope measurements were carried out to investigate the texture of the surface of the samplesFor the silicate glass - ceramic samples , sodium calcium silicate was identified as the main crystalline phaseBy the addition of MgO or TiO2 , a second minor phase was formed and was identified as calcium phosphateThe silicate glass - ceramic samples showed almost complete crystallization and the infrared absorption spectra revealed the presence of the characteristic peaks of the SiO4 groups inside the crystalline phasesFor the phosphate glass - ceramic samples , the calcium pyrophosphate was identified as the main crystalline phase in all the samplesThe base sample without addition of TiO2 showed also the presence of sodium metaphosphate , which was present in all the samples with considerable amounts , and other minor phases (calcium metaphosphate , sodium pyrophosphate , sodium calcium metaphosphate) By the addition of TiO2 , the crystalline phase sodium calcium phosphate was disappeared and the sodium metaphosphate was decreased except in sample P5 with TiO2 = 2 mol In hundered persent where the amount of sodium metaphosphate was still high as in the base sampleAlso , a new crystalline phase was formed , which can be identified as sodium titanium phosphate
